Gyeongbuk Province Selects 15 Promising SMEs as 'Star Companies'
[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Choi Jae-ho] Gyeongbuk Province will hold the '2021 Gyeongbuk Regional Star Company Designation Certificate Award Ceremony' at the provincial office on the 7th.
The Star Company Development Project is hosted by the Ministry of SMEs and Startups and Gyeongbuk Province, and organized by Gyeongbuk TP. It is a project to nurture companies with regional growth potential into strong small and medium enterprises.
Through a recruitment announcement in February, after eligibility review, on-site inspection, and presentation evaluation, 15 companies were finally selected: Gyeongdo Industrial, Damtta Fresh, Myeongsan, Saehaeseong, MD Industry, Yeongnam Technology, Yes Korea, Yongjin, G-Tech, Korea Food, Koa System, Taesan, Pro Green Tech, Handok, and Hanseung Chemical.
By main industry, 7 companies were selected in advanced new material parts processing, 4 in eco-friendly convergence textile materials, 2 in intelligent digital devices, and 2 in life care beauty. Their average sales last year were 14.7 billion KRW, average export amount was 4.6 billion KRW, and average employment was 43 people.
Companies selected as 2021 Gyeongbuk Regional Star Companies will receive support programs worth up to 45 million KRW, including growth strategy establishment for mid- to long-term item discovery, marketing strategy establishment, R&D planning, and dedicated PM consulting. Next year, they plan to support technology development funds worth up to 400 million KRW.
The Star Company Development Project started in 2018 and has selected and supported 46 companies up to last year. In particular, three companies?IJS, Nature Farm, and Ace Nanocam?have grown into global strong small and medium enterprises. One Biogen is systematically supported at each growth stage, including its listing on KOSDAQ this year.
